Handover note — Wavelet Preview widget (for the weekly sync)

Hey, passing the audio waveform preview over before I rotate onto the Tidemark project. State of things: rendering is solid up to ~30 min clips, but longer files still choke the downsampler — there's a draft fix on the feature branch that needs a real review. The color theming ticket is half-done; the dark-mode gradients look muddy. Tests are green except one flaky zoom case. Any questions after this week shouldn't come to me; the new owner is named below.

named custodian: Brivan Eliath Quenox Frador

The garage occupancy feed for the Brindlewood campus arrives over a message queue every thirty seconds, one record per level, published by the Stallgrid edge boxes. Counts can briefly go negative when a sensor double-fires on exit; the ingest job clamps these to zero and flags the interval. If the feed stalls for more than five minutes, the dashboard falls back to the last known snapshot. Sensor mappings, queue names, and the replay procedure are documented on the internal page below.

runbook for tahog-kadug: https://gitlab.qirvanworks.corp/projects/pages/view/b139298aed28

**Ticket QV-2231: Encoding detection drift on upload nodes**

Plugin authors report Quillvane's text-upload encoding sniffer behaving differently across regions. Two nodes still run the legacy chardet fallback; the rest use the new BOM-first strategy, so the same CSV parses as UTF-8 on one node and Latin-1 on another. Plugins must not work around this — we will converge the fleet this week. Until then, target the canonical settings listed below.

settings of tagef-bawif:
DRUIX_HOST=druix.zemvarlabs.internal
DRUIX_PORT=8000

Release checklist item — Stockhollow barcode scanner integration: verify that the new decoder module handles damaged Code-128 labels by falling back to the secondary read pass rather than returning an empty SKU. Review the retry ceiling (three attempts) and confirm the scanner firmware handshake no longer blocks the main inventory thread. Regression suite passed on both handheld and fixed-mount units in the Ferndale warehouse lab. Confirm the reviewed commit matches the build reference below.

build token for kagaf-hahof: htk14_9d3d4d26d7d8de